Three-fifths, written as 3/5, can also be expressed as 0.6 in decimal notation. Using a calculator, one can determine the decimal form of a fraction by dividing the numerator by the denominator.

Using a calculator is the simplest technique to convert a fraction to a decimal, however certain numbers can also be transformed through manipulation and scrutiny. By multiplying the numerator and denominator by 2, the fraction 3/5 can be converted to 6/10. Most people can divide 6 by 10 by shifting the decimal point to the left by one position, resulting in the proper decimal number 0.6.
